会用C#的请进 ( 积分: 200 )

M

muhx

Unregistered / Unconfirmed
GUEST, unregistred user!
正在学习C#,虽然Delphi好但总要给自己多条路。
欢迎正在学习C#和精通C#的朋友一起讨论,共同提高
比如对C#,.NET的理解,推荐的书籍,经验很教训,谢谢
参与就有分,不够继续加。
大家一起讨论啊
 
正在学习C#,虽然Delphi好但总要给自己多条路。
欢迎正在学习C#和精通C#的朋友一起讨论,共同提高
比如对C#,.NET的理解,推荐的书籍,经验很教训,谢谢
参与就有分,不够继续加。
大家一起讨论啊
 
我也想学呢,请推荐一本电子版入门的好书
 
我现在在看《C#完全手册》
说来好笑,我每周六去图书馆蹭书看
看21天学通C#,人民有点出版社出版的
主要怕买了大部头之后就放在一边不看了
 
人过留声,雁过拔毛
 
http://bbs.hidotnet.com/8437/ShowPost.aspx 多去这里看看
 
http://bbs.hidotnet.com/8198/ShowPost.aspx
 
如果你明白一种编程语言,再看其它的就容易多了。其实很多语言都是相通的。
我以前用VB和PB,但因为用delphi做程序,我边用边学,2个月就可以写一些程序了。C#我从接触到实用,1周就写了一个阴阳万年历备忘录自动提醒程序。
 
To:wzquan
我认为语言只是一种载体
关键是其中实现的思想
为什么要用.Net
我想C#不单单一种语言那么简单
说道编程,呵呵我只学了一个小时就能够编一个简单的程序了-
Hello World
呵呵
 
同意楼上的说法其实写程序重要的是思想,而不是编程语言!
我现在同时在用三种语言写程序:java/C#/delphi.开发工具用:JBUILDER/WSAD/ECLIPS/VS.NET/DELPHI
其实重要的是在系统设计的初期关心系统整体的设计,而不必过多关心用什么语言来实现
重要的是你能把握在特定的项目中什么编程语言最适合而对于系统的构思都是一样的.
 
lyjwolf大侠能不能详细一点谈谈你使用三种语言的感受?
 
偶上周刚被迫用C#封装了一个C++做的底层DLL库,里边N多指针、N多结构体参数、N多WIN API,C#在语法细节上和DELPHI、C++相差N大,WIN32平台和.NET平台更是两个概念。学C#建议先学好C#的语法再把握好.NET的框架。其实多数人并不能真正的掌握好语法,这块上得多下功夫。
 
谢谢楼上的,我也觉得语法相差很大
 
C#声称没有全局变量,所有的东西都封装成类,是完全的面向对象
于是我在我的Delphi程序中也希望借助这个原则
但真的执行起来发现难度很大
全局变量还好说
封装成一个类,作为类的域和属性,使用类的方法来改变属性值
但是一些公共的函数如果封装成类使用起来就太麻烦了
而且我如果写成DLL,调用也是一个问题
迷茫中
 
陈宽达的《Delphi深度历险》中说他的做法是不拘泥于此
他还是写成他的链接库(实际上是一个单元中,所有的函数和过程都为全局的),使用的时候直接Uses这个“链接库”,像使用Delphi本身的库一样方便
这也是一个好的方法
 
大家不要只看不说话啊
留个言啊
 
留名就有分
大家快来回答啊
 
偶觉得一个从面向过程到面向对象的思想上的转变还是得从设计模式入手,读完这本书(虽然很是枯燥)你就会明白用面向对象比面向过程带来的更多可复用性。。。
 
请大家继续讨论,
谢谢
 
现在开始抢分啦
到明天为止所有在这里留言的将送上分
 

Similar threads

D
回复
0
查看
713
DelphiTeacher的专栏
D
D
回复
0
查看
2K
DelphiTeacher的专栏
D
D
回复
0
查看
1K
DelphiTeacher的专栏
D
D
回复
0
查看
873
DelphiTeacher的专栏
D
D
回复
0
查看
773
DelphiTeacher的专栏
D
顶部